WebJun 20, 2024 · Photo 6: Apply thin coats. Spray lacquer on surfaces by starting the spray off the work and then moving it over the surface and off the other side before taking your finger off the trigger. Allow a few hours before sanding and recoating. If you’re not in a hurry, it’s easier to sand if you allow overnight curing. WebApr 11, 2024 · 1. WebJan 23, 2024 · Prior to applying the stain, we had a few steps we needed to do to prep the surface. We started off by wetting the entire surface using a shop towel. This makes the wood grain lift a little, which allows the stain to penetrate better into the wood. We let the surface dry for 2 hours. However, re-sanding to get the wood smooth again removes much … raymond\u0027s landscaping hendersonville ncWebSep 2, 2024 · First clean the table well to remove any oils, etc on it. Scuff the finish with 220 grit sandpaper to give the paint some 'tooth' to stick. Apply a coat of stain-blocking primer, let it dry and then paint white. I would use a latex enamel for a good finish.
